Pall Mall development site up for sale
A redevelopment opportunity at 70-90 Pall Mall, close to Liverpool city centre, has entered the market with offers being invited in excess of £2m.
In addition to a 12-storey hotel, the 2.7-acre site has outline planning permission for a multi-storey car park, offices and workshops.
Full planning permission is already in place for class B1 offices and class A1 retail, subject to agreeing the S106 agreement.
The property currently comprises a series of vacant interconnecting industrial, office and ancillary buildings, with extensive hard standing areas.
The site is located half a mile north of Liverpool city centre on the eastern side of Pall Mall, close to its junction with Leeds Street, and three miles to the east of junction five of the M62.
The marketing of the site is being handled by the Manchester office of chartered surveyors Eddisons, which is acting on the instructions of the joint LPA Receivers.
